If there’s one particular word which comes to mind while both describing critically-hailed saxophonist MIKE PHILLIPS and an ongoing theme of his illustrious music career within the jazz, R&B and even hip-hop worlds, it would be “authentic.” If the primary meanings of the word refers to something or someone “of undisputed origin” or “genuinely based on origins,” then Phillips’ unusually high appreciation for music since early childhood, which manifested into everything from absorbing and learning musical instruments and immersing himself into all things music – both past and present – then his widely-noted, soulfully warm saxophone-driven sound sonically and melodically personifies the term. Consequently, only musicians and singers of first-rate authenticity can manage to convey such originality and confidence while conveying long-cherished musical nuggets we’re already intimately familiar with. MIKE PHILLIPS manages to do all the above (and more!) with his latest groove-driven smooth-jazz musical offering, Pulling Off The Covers,
